Type
Gremlin expression of type a
.
Greskell
is essentially just a piece of Gremlin script with a
phantom type. The type a
represents the type of data that the
script is supposed to evaluate to.
Eq
and Ord
instances compare Gremlin scripts, NOT the values
they evaluate to.

Literals
Functions to create literals in Gremlin script. Use fromInteger
,
valueInt
or gvalueInt
to create integer literals. Use
fromRational
or number
to create floating-point data literals.
string :: Text -> Greskell Text Source #
Create a String literal in Gremlin script. The content is automatically escaped.
single :: Greskell a -> Greskell [a] Source #
Make a list with a single object. Useful to prevent the Gremlin Server from automatically iterating the result object.
number :: Scientific -> Greskell Scientific Source #
Arbitrary precision number literal, like "123e8".

Unsafe constructors
Unsafely create a Greskell
of arbitrary type. The given Gremlin
script is printed as-is.
Same as unsafeGreskell
, but it takes lazy Text
.
Unsafely create a Greskell
that calls the given function with
the given arguments.
